Cordless Planer
Bosch recently announced the addition of the 18-volt and the 14.4-volt 3 ¼-in. cordless planers to its continually growing cordless power tool family. Each planer includes two reversible Bosch Woodrazor micrograin carbide blades, which provide a finer finish, up to 30 percent longer life than standard carbide blades and resistant fractures from accidental nail or staple strikes. The unique electronically balanced single blade-cutting head holds the Woodrazor blade at an optimal angle, to provide fastest results, smoothest finish and longest battery life. Both planers also feature the Bosch patented two-way chip ejection switch to direct shavings either left or right and an ambidextrous lock off switch accessible from either side. Grinder
Vemeer Manufacturing Co. is expanding its environmental solutions with
the introduction of a product that builds upon its proven grinding technologies.
The stationary HG365E electric-powered horizontal grinder has been configured
to meet a variety of on-site grinding functions and can function as a
stand-alone waste reduction machine or may operate as one component of
a larger waste reduction system. A 250-hp, 460-volt three-phase Baldor
electric motor powers the hammermill. A separate electric 50-hp Baldor
motor drives all other hydraulic functions. The HG365E has a large 14-ft.
by 50-in. open-end feed conveyor to accommodate certain materials without

Laser Control System
Trimble recently introduced the GCS400, a laser-based machine control
system that simultaneously controls lift and tilt of a dozer blade. The
GCS400 delivers greater job site efficiency, easier operation, more consistent
accuracy and reduced costs. In addition to simultaneously controlling
a dozer's lift and tilt functions from a single box, the GSC400 system
gives the option to select from two elevation control modes. One is "independent
mode," which allows the operator to control the lift and tilt functions
independently from each other. The other is the "linked mode,"
which ties the lift and tilt functions together, allowing the operator

Rockbreaker System
The new MBS Series rockbreaker system is an on-plant solution for highly
portable aggregate and recycle applications. Unlike conventional boom
systems that must be removed from the crushing plant or permanently mounted
on a separate trailer, the new MBS Series models are designed to remain
on the plant due to an exclusive low profile design, which allows the
boom to be lowered flat onto the feeder below the height of the flywheel
for road transportation. Designed to be installed or retrofitted to new
or existing wheeled- or track-mounted crushing plants, MBS Series models
are lightweight and low profile, resulting in a significant reduction
in mounting and interfacing costs when compared with conventional boom

Spray Gun
Gusmer Corp. has renamed the GX8 Spray Gun to the GX8-Pro, which features
several new improvements to the mechanically self-cleaning low output
spray gun. The most significant improvement to the gun came from widening
the air passageways to the gun's air cap and trigger valve. This modification
provides more air volume to the spray tip so it operates cleaner, longer.
The increased air volume to the trigger valve provides faster opening
and closing of the gun. This speeds up impingement and allows for quick,
rapid triggering for detail spraying without sacrificing mixing quality.

Vacuum Excavation System
The Ditch Witch FX60 Vacuum Excavation System combines enhanced "soft"
excavation capabilities and increased vacuum power in a compact, trailer-
or skid-mounted unit. For excavating, soils are displaced by water at
pressures to 3500 psi . Powered by a 56-horsepower diesel engine, the
unit's belt-driven blower develops maximum airflow of 900 cfm at 16-in.
of mercury for vacuuming. For most efficient use of power, the clutch
automatically disengages when water is not in use, allowing fill power
